Size Kink
Size kink is an erotic fascination with size differences between partners — height disparities, differences in physical build, or the sensation of being physically overwhelmed or engulfed by a larger partner. It also encompasses fantasies involving exaggerated size (giantess/giant fantasies, shrinking fantasies) that exist primarily in imagination and creative media.
Why People Enjoy It
Size differences between partners create an immediate, visceral power dynamic. A physically larger partner can envelop, lift, pin, and physically control a smaller partner with ease — and this physical reality translates directly into psychological experiences of dominance, protection, vulnerability, or helplessness that many people find deeply arousing.
For the smaller partner, being physically overwhelmed can produce a feeling of safety-through-surrender — being held, contained, and overpowered by someone who is trusted. The size difference makes the power exchange tangible and inescapable in a way that verbal dynamics alone cannot achieve.
For the larger partner, the awareness of their physical advantage — and the responsibility that comes with it — can enhance feelings of protectiveness, dominance, and tenderness. The contrast between their strength and their gentleness becomes its own form of eroticism.
Fantasy-based size kink (macrophilia/microphilia) extends these dynamics to their imaginative extreme, exploring what total size disparity would feel like through art, writing, and role-play.
Expressions of Size Kink
Height Difference Play
Partners with significant height differences may eroticize the disparity through standing positions, the taller partner looking down, the shorter partner looking up, or positions that emphasize the size gap.
Strength & Physical Dominance
The larger partner uses their physical advantage during intimacy — pinning, lifting, carrying, or restraining the smaller partner with their body rather than equipment.
Body Proportions
Fascination with specific size-related features: large hands that envelop smaller ones, broad shoulders, the contrast between a thick and a slender body, or a partner whose hands can span your waist.
Giantess / Giant Fantasy (Macro)
Fantasies involving one partner growing to enormous size — towering over buildings, holding a tiny partner in their hand. This exists primarily in art, animation, and imagination.
Shrinking Fantasy (Micro)
The complement to macro — fantasies of being shrunk to miniature size, creating extreme vulnerability and size disparity. Explored through creative media and role-play.
Incorporating Size Kink Into Intimacy
- Physical positions: Choose positions that emphasize size differences — the larger partner on top, standing while the smaller partner kneels, or carrying the smaller partner
- Verbal play: Commenting on size during intimacy — "you're so small in my arms," "your hands are huge" — verbalizes and amplifies the dynamic
- Restraint through body: Using body weight and strength to pin or hold a partner rather than rope or cuffs makes the size dynamic the restraint itself
- Lifting & carrying: Picking up a partner, throwing them onto a bed, or holding them against a wall uses physical size as an expression of desire
- Fantasy exploration: Share macro/micro fantasies through storytelling, art, or role-play scenarios where size differences are imagined to be extreme
Getting Started
If you are drawn to size differences, reflect on what specifically excites you. Is it the feeling of being overwhelmed? The visual contrast? The power dynamic? The protectiveness? Understanding your specific driver helps you communicate it to a partner and find ways to emphasize it in your intimacy.
Share your interest with a partner by highlighting what you find attractive about your size dynamic: "I love how your body feels around mine" or "It turns me on when you pick me up." Most partners are delighted to learn that their physical characteristics are a source of arousal.
